Overview
Murals are pieces of graphic artwork painted or applied directly to a wall, ceiling, or other permanent substrate, encompassing various techniques such as fresco, mosaic, graffiti, and marouflage. The term 'mural' is derived from the Latin word 'murus,' meaning wall. Murals can be found in a wide range of locations, from public buildings and museums to private homes and commercial spaces. As a form of public art, murals have the power to transform urban environments and provide a platform for artists to convey their messages.
